Between the dirty dishes that never unstack or the birthday card that's never delivered on time, life seems to get more hectic as we get older. And while we can't all have a live-in butler like the Banks family, the future is looking a little brighter (and cleaner) with our new favorite chore-tackler-in-grime, Thanks Geoffrey.

Thanks Geoffrey is a trustworthy, affordable butler service that frees you from the dust and gives you time to focus on what’s really important (like sticking to your gym routine). We recently spoke with founder, Michael Patrick, to find out how they tackle tasks for everyday folks like you and me for under $40 a week.

"It is a shared butler service for busy people that is affordable and attainable for everyone. We call it 'shared' because you need an hour of a butler's time instead of an eight full hour day," said Patrick (pictured). "The key to the service is to allow clients do more things through an assistant who is thoughtful. We hire smart Geoffreys, who are used to thinking ahead to prompt clients for other services they may need."

Before launching into entrepreneurship, Patrick got his start as a financial advisor with little to no time on his hands for errands. In a quest to find a service outside of a traditional concierge, Patrick came up empty-handed and did what any (truly inspired) man desperate to keep everyday drudgeries at bay would do - create a company that could help pick up the slack.

"ThanksGeoffrey is a trust company," said Patrick. "Our Geoffreys are selected very carefully. Particularly, our goal is to recruit former teachers, who have been vetted by the state, understand planning, and are good with kids and families."

The service works much like the a trash service. For "The Standard," you pick one day a week for a Geoffrey to come to your home and help with chores ranging from taking out trash and washing dishes, to mailing packages and coordinating home repairs. With extra time after chores, the Geoffrey will help with small tasks like buying a gift for an upcoming baby shower. And just in case you need extra help, you can receive the "White Glove Service" for $68 per week. This includes two visits to your home with services like grocery shopping, automatically restocking pantry staples, and following up with service work from vendors.
